Texas Lawn Replacement. If you’re looking for a lawn alternative in texas, you might consider clover, buffalo grass, or even xeriscaping. Everything from fire pit seating areas to native plants can replace your current lawn. Once established, a lawn full of native plants almost never needs watering, which will make your lawn the most attractive in your neighborhood when drought turns all the other yards brown.
